Nevada AB 176 (80) — Enacts the Sexual Assault Survivors' Bill of Rights. (BDR 14-87)
AN ACT relating to crimes; enacting the Sexual Assault Survivors' Bill of Rights; defining certain terms relating to victims of sexual assault; creating the Advisory Committee on the Rights of Survivors of Sexual Assault; prescribing the membership and duties of the Advisory Committee; requiring certain information to be provided to a victim of sexual assault; revising certain provisions relating to sexual assault forensic analysis kits; making an appropriation; and providing other matters properly relating thereto.

Timeline
The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.
- 2019-02-18T08:00:00+00:00 Read first time. Referred to Committee on Judiciary. To printer.
reading-1, referral-committee - 2019-02-19T08:00:00+00:00 From printer. To committee.
- 2019-02-25T08:00:00+00:00 Notice of eligibility for exemption.
- 2019-04-22T07:00:00+00:00 From committee: Amend, and do pass as amended. Placed on Second Reading File. Read second time. Amended. (Amend. No. 572.) Rereferred to Committee on Ways and Means. Exemption effective. To printer.
committee-passage - 2019-04-23T07:00:00+00:00 From printer. To engrossment. Engrossed. First reprint. To committee.
- 2019-05-27T07:00:00+00:00 From committee: Amend, and do pass as amended. Placed on General File. Read third time. Amended. (Amend. No. 915.) To printer.
committee-passage - 2019-05-28T07:00:00+00:00 From printer. To reengrossment. Reengrossed. Second reprint. Read third time. Passed, as amended. Title approved, as amended. (Yeas: 40, Nays: None, Excused: 1, Vacant: 1.) To Senate. In Senate. Read first time. Referred to Committee on Judiciary. To committee.
- 2019-06-02T07:00:00+00:00 From committee: Amend, and do pass as amended. Placed on Second Reading File. Read second time. Amended. (Amend. No. 1085.) To printer. From printer. To re-engrossment. Re-engrossed. Third reprint.
committee-passage - 2019-06-03T07:00:00+00:00 Read third time. Passed, as amended. Title approved. (Yeas: 21, Nays: None.) To Assembly. In Assembly. Senate Amendment No. 1085 concurred in. To enrollment.
passage, reading-3 - 2019-06-06T07:00:00+00:00 Enrolled and delivered to Governor.
executive-receipt - 2019-06-07T07:00:00+00:00 Approved by the Governor.
executive-signature - 2019-06-10T07:00:00+00:00 Chapter 478.
